Check out Montgomery History‘s upcoming webinar – George W. Meads: “Rockville’s One-Man Fire Department.”
From 1895 through 1920, Prior to the founding of the RVFD, the volunteer fire department in Rockville consisted of a dedicated group of civic-minded Black men led by the first Fire Chief in the town’s history: George Meads. Archivist Sarah Hedlund relates the story of Meads’s extraordinary life as a fireman, deputy sheriff, school trustee, entrepreneur, and family man, intertwined with the early history of firefighting and other aspects of segregated community life in turn-of-the-century Rockville.
